How to Choose the Best Dry Bag for Kayaking & Watersports
Size
The size of a waterproof bag is most commonly expressed in its capacity in liters with bags ranging from 1 liter to 120 liters or more. The appropriate size depends on the activity you have in mind and the space available. For day trips 10L to 20L may be enough to bring along the food, clothes, and daily use items you require. If you are going for longer journeys or that involve more people, more capacity may be required. Kayaks are known for a limited amount of space in the cockpit and storage wells or with webbing, so you should plan not to exceed the allotted space.
Durability
With the bumps and scrapes possible in kayaking, durability is key to maintaining the integrity and waterproofing level of the bag, not to mention the protection of the contents.
The base material will usually be a form of nylon, polyester, or vinyl that can include some sort of specialized lamination or coating to increase the water resistance level. Look for sealed seams and reinforced vulnerable areas, especially the bottom.
Closure
To keep water out, most waterproof bags use a roll-top closure system that is pretty reliable. Many companies have incorporated some extra features to enhance the seal. Another popular system has a zip-lock design for the initial seal followed by rolling.
Straps and Handles
Waterproof bags come in a range of options regarding straps, handles, and the like. Many just have a basic place to grab on. The roll-top closure area can be such a place. Others have specific handles, shoulder straps, or twin backpack-style straps. The larger the bag the more necessary it is to have options to make portage easy and comfortable. Many larger bags have padded twin straps and may include a sternum strap or belt to accomplish this.
Visibility
Many of the waterproof bags used for kayaking and water sports are brightly colored. Colors like neon yellow or green increase visibility in low light which can be useful for spotting your bag if it has gone overboard or for helping other boaters and kayakers to see you, as well. A reflector on the bag can have the same effect.
